Having bed bugs in your mattresses, sofa, or carpets can be uncomfortable and unpleasant. They use a stylet, a piece of their mouth, to pierce our skin for blood, which is their main food source. They can leave red, swelling bite marks on your skin. Bites can trigger rashes or other skin reactions for those with sensitive skin. Bed bugs are most commonly found in households. Fabrics, linens, and clothes provide ideal hiding spots for bed bugs. Their small size makes them difficult to locate in your home. Bites may alert you to bed bugs, but spotting them is often tricky.
Unlike many other spiders that spin neat webs, the brown recluse creates webs that appear uneven and tangled. If you come across a web that looks like a tangled mass of threads, it may belong to a brown recluse — and you should get professional help without delay.
